The cheapest way to get from Boston to Davis is to fly and BART and train which costs $170 - $650 and takes 10h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Boston to Davis is to fly which takes 8h 10m and costs $290 - $1,200.
No, there is no direct train from Boston to Davis. However, there are services departing from Boston and arriving at Davis via Chicago Union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3 days 2h.
The distance between Boston and Davis is 2669 miles. The road distance is 3037.3 miles.
The best way to get from Boston to Davis without a car is to train which takes 3 days 2h and costs $340 - $3,100.
It takes approximately 8h 10m to get from Boston to Davis, including transfers.
Boston to Davis train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Boston station.
The best way to get from Boston to Davis is to fly which takes 8h 10m and costs $290 - $1,200.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$340 - $3,100 and takes 3 days 2h.
Davis is 3h behind Boston. It is currently 5:19 AM in Boston and 2:19 AM in Davis.
